vb@rchiv
VB Classic
VB.NET
ADO.NET
VBA
C#
sevAniGif - als kostenlose Vollversion auf unserer vb@rchiv CD Vol.5  
 vb@rchiv Quick-Search: Suche startenErweiterte Suche starten   Impressum  | Datenschutz  | vb@rchiv CD Vol.6  | Shop Copyright ©2000-2024
 
zurück

 Sie sind aktuell nicht angemeldet.Funktionen: Einloggen  |  Neu registrieren  |  Suchen

Visual-Basic Einsteiger
ich weiß nicht wie das heißt 
Autor: dj.tommy
Datum: 08.08.05 21:50

Ich möchte mich höfflichst entschuldigen!
ich habe im betreff "Wer kann mir helfen" des wegen geschrieben weil ich nicht weiß wie das heißt.
sonst schreibe ich immer um was es geht.
hmm das mit dem smiley habe ich auch so.
nur weiß ich das nicht wie ich das mit wav mache.
hier ein ein code von smiley
Public Sub Create_Smileys(RTF As Control)
  Dim Smileys() As String
  Dim SmileysFile() As String
  Dim Smilestring As String
  Dim audiostring As String
  Dim SmileFileString As String
   Dim audioFileString As String
  Dim i As Integer
  Dim Pos As Long, Start As Long
  Dim IconPath As String
 
  Screen.MousePointer = vbHourglass
  Pos = RTF.SelStart
  Start = 1
  IconPath = App.Path & "\smileys\"
                     '  das meine ich 
  Smilestring = ":-) :-) :( :-( ;) ;-)  :o :D :p :cool: :rolleyes: :mad:"
  'Smilestring da sind smiley zeichen drin 
  SmileFileString = "smiley1.gif,smiley1.gif," & _
    "smiley2.gif,smiley2.gif," & _
    "smiley3.gif,smiley3.gif," & _
    "smiley4.gif,smiley5.gif," & _
    "smiley6.gif,smiley7.gif," & _
    "smiley8.gif,smiley9.gif"
 
  Smileys = Split(Smilestring, " ")
  SmileysFile = Split(SmileFileString, ",")
 
  If UBound(Smileys) <> UBound(SmileysFile) Then
    MsgBox "Ungleiche Anzahl."
    Exit Sub
  End If
 
  For i = LBound(Smileys) To UBound(Smileys)
    While RTF.Find(Smileys(i), Start - 1) >= 0
      Picture1.Picture = LoadPicture(Trim$(IconPath & SmileysFile(i)))
      RTF.SelStart = RTF.Find(Smileys(i), Start - 1)
      RTF.SelLength = Len(Smileys(i))
      Start = RTF.SelStart + RTF.SelLength + 1
      RTF.SelText = ""
      CopyPictureToRTF RTF, Picture1.Picture
    Wend
    Start = 1
  Next i
 
  RTF.SelStart = Pos
  Screen.MousePointer = vbNormal
End Sub
 
Private Sub CopyPictureToRTF(RTF As Control, Bild As Picture)
  Dim Buf As Variant
  Dim Text As String
 
  If Clipboard.GetFormat(vbCFText) = True Then
    Text = Clipboard.GetText
  Else
    Buf = Clipboard.GetData
  End If
 
  Clipboard.Clear
  Clipboard.SetData Picture1.Picture
  DoEvents
 
  ' Bild per SendMessage in RTF-Box einfügen
  SendMessage RTF.hwnd, WM_PASTE, 0, 0
  DoEvents
  Sleep 30 
 
 
  Clipboard.Clear
 
 
  If Text <> "" Then
    Clipboard.SetText Text
  Else
    If Buf <> 0 Then
      Clipboard.SetData Buf
    End If
  End If
End Sub
alle Nachrichten anzeigenGesamtübersicht  |  Zum Thema  |  Suchen

 ThemaViews  AutorDatum
Wer kann mir hilfen!487dj.tommy08.08.05 20:45
Re: Wer kann mir hilfen!306WaTeRwOrLd08.08.05 20:53
ich weiß nicht wie das heißt308dj.tommy08.08.05 21:50
Re: Wer kann mir hilfen!268lighty09.08.05 08:45
Re: Wer kann mir hilfen!277dj.tommy09.08.05 10:14
Re: Wer kann mir hilfen!274lighty10.08.05 09:48
Re: Wer kann mir hilfen!302dj.tommy10.08.05 09:52

Sie sind nicht angemeldet!
Um auf diesen Beitrag zu antworten oder neue Beiträge schreiben zu können, müssen Sie sich zunächst anmelden.

Einloggen  |  Neu registrieren

Funktionen:  Zum Thema  |  GesamtübersichtSuchen 

nach obenzurück
 
   

Copyright ©2000-2024 vb@rchiv Dieter Otter
Alle Rechte vorbehalten.
Microsoft, Windows und Visual Basic sind entweder eingetragene Marken oder Marken der Microsoft Corporation in den USA und/oder anderen Ländern. Weitere auf dieser Homepage aufgeführten Produkt- und Firmennamen können geschützte Marken ihrer jeweiligen Inhaber sein.

Diese Seiten wurden optimiert für eine Bildschirmauflösung von mind. 1280x1024 Pixel